Saturday we made it back to PAX with the idea of spending the day in panel discussions. We of course ended up wandering the grounds taking everything in again (the people watching is nothing short of epic), playing more games in the exhibition hall, and only made it to a couple of panels before calling it a day.
The first panel we attended featured prominent members of female-oriented gaming communities, talking about how their communities operate, the place they hold in the industry, and of course, the changing roles of females in gaming. The Q&A revealed a lot of interest from the girls in the crowd in what they were doing, with plenty of them looking to dispel the image that the only kind of "gamer chick" out there is one either at their boyfriend's side or sensuously cradling a piece of gear.
Less academic and more funny was the Giant Bomb reunion panel, which could be summed up as a bunch of dudes just hanging out riffing off of one another. Sure, they talked about their game review site, the games some panelists work on, and at one point, a panelist's cat, but they touched on bigger issues as well. In between the jokes, they mentioned the ideas of integrity in reviews, how to get a foothold in the industry, and discussed the failings of the current ratings system. It was informative, even though that seemed secondary to overall entertainment.
